I have always been a fan of the tournaments. Mostly because in cash games, I tend to get a little bored with the monotony of the deep stacks. In tournaments their tends to be much more variation int the stack sizes which changes the game. That extra level has kept my attention better which allows me to put in a greater volume of tournaments than I ever could at cash.

I think it is different for each individual though and it is best to figure out what works for you !

I prefer tournaments. I feel more pressure when playing cash games because you are playing with real money chips. In tournaments you use real money for the buy in and then play with tournament chips. Somehow I find this less intimidating.
